ตัวอย่าง
พิมพ์ออกแถวได้รับผลกระทบจากคำสั่งที่แตกต่างกัน
<?php
$con=mysqli_connect("localhost","my_user","my_password","my_db");
if (mysqli_connect_errno())
{
echo "Failed to connect to MySQL: " . mysqli_connect_error();
}
// Perform queries and print out affected rows
mysqli_query($con,"SELECT *
FROM Persons");
echo "Affected rows: " . mysqli_affected_rows($con);
mysqli_query($con,"DELETE FROM Persons WHERE Age>32");
echo "Affected
rows: " . mysqli_affected_rows($con);
mysqli_close($con);
?>
ความหมายและการใช้งาน
mysqli_affected_rows() ฟังก์ชันส่งกลับจำนวนแถวได้รับผลกระทบในการเลือกก่อนหน้านี้ INSERT, UPDATE เปลี่ยนหรือลบแบบสอบถาม
วากยสัมพันธ์
mysqli_affected_rows( connection ) ;
พารามิเตอร์ | ลักษณะ |
---|---|
connection | จำเป็นต้องใช้ ระบุการเชื่อมต่อ MySQL เพื่อใช้ |
รายละเอียดทางเทคนิค
กลับค่า: | จำนวนเต็ม> 0 แสดงจำนวนแถวที่ได้รับผลกระทบ 0 แสดงว่าไม่มีระเบียนได้รับผลกระทบ -1 บ่งชี้ว่าแบบสอบถามที่ส่งกลับข้อผิดพลาด |
---|---|
PHP เวอร์ชัน: | 5+ |
<PHP MySQLi อ้างอิง